Output 6de60a6b658516038ec9b041f00689f69125682ab86479d5ac3ef4af6d80d4e8:0

value
522510786
script pubkey
OP_0 OP_PUSHBYTES_20 4b21f5f0d690bf72c7019a44c25c9dadb944a743
address
bc1qfvsltuxkjzlh93cpnfzvyhya4ku5ff6r8qzel3
transaction
6de60a6b658516038ec9b041f00689f69125682ab86479d5ac3ef4af6d80d4e8
spent
true